Hiawatha, IA Auto Insurance Rates Based on the Age of the Driver | Back to Top

Teenagers in Hiawatha, IA usually pay a much higher car insurance rate compared to the rest of the state as they are generally considered to be less responsible behind the wheel. Middle-aged drivers are likely to pay lower car insurance premiums if they are considered to be safer drivers by insurance companies.

Age of Driver Insurance Cost
Teens $3,339
20 Years $1,322
30 Years $1,018
40 Years $980
50 Years $907
60 Years $920
70 Years $1,071

Hiawatha, IA Auto Insurance Rates Based on Credit Score | Back to Top

Car insurance companies can use the Credit Score of car drivers to determine car insurance rates. Car drivers with good credit can avail of substantial discounts on car insurance rates.

Credit Score Insurance Cost
Exceptional (800-850) $883
Excellent (740-799) $1,008
Good (670-739) $1,072
Average (580-669) $1,399
Poor (300-579) $1,678

Hiawatha, IA Auto Insurance Rates can Increase Based on Driving Violations | Back to Top

Auto insurance rates tend to increase depending on the type and number of driving violations. The driving violations can stay on the record for a considerable amount of time leading to higher auto insurance rates. The severity of the driving violation and place of residence will determine how long the violation stays on record.

Driving Violation Cost Increase Total Insurance Cost
Driving Without Headlights +$45 $1,074
Driver's Failure In Showing Documents +$100 $1,129
Driving With An Expired Registration +$106 $1,135
Driving At A Considerably Slow Pace +$223 $1,252
Using A Cellphone While Driving +$236 $1,265
Running A Red Light +$240 $1,269
Speeding +$252 $1,281
Driving A Vehicle Without The Required Permission +$320 $1,349
Driving With An Expired/Suspended License +$694 $1,723
